NVIDIA GeForce RTX 2070 Max-Q vs AMD Radeon Pro 5600M
What is the difference between NVIDIA GeForce RTX 2070 Max-Q and AMD Radeon Pro 5600M. Find out which graphics card has better performance.
Graphics Processor (GPU)
| TU106 | GPU Name | Navi 12 |
| N18E-G2-A1 | Model number | Navi 12 |
| Turing | Architecture | RDNA 1.0 |
| TSMC | Foundry | TSMC |
| 12 nm | Process Size | 7 nm |
| 10,800 million | Transistors | unknown |
| 445 mm² | Die Size | unknown |
Graphics Card
| Jan 29th, 2019 | Release Date | Jun 15th, 2020 |
| GeForce 20 Mobile | Family | Radeon Pro Mac (Navi Mobile) |
| Active | Production | Active |
| PCIe 3.0 x16 | Bus Interface | PCIe 4.0 x16 |
Memory
| 8 GB | Memory Size | 8 GB |
| GDDR6 | Memory Type | HBM2 |
| 256 bit | Memory Bus | 2048 bit |
| 384.0 GB/s | Bandwidth | 394.2 GB/s |
Performance
| 75.84 GPixel/s | Pixel fillrate | 66.24 GPixel/s |
| 170.6 GTexel/s | Texture fillrate | 165.6 GTexel/s |
| 10.92 TFLOPS (2:1) | FP16 (half) performance | 10.60 TFLOPS (2:1) |
| 5.460 TFLOPS | FP32 (float) performance | 5.299 TFLOPS |
| 170.6 GFLOPS (1:32) | FP64 (double) performance | 331.2 GFLOPS (1:16) |
Clock Speeds
| 885 MHz | Base Clock | 1000 MHz |
| 1185 MHz | Boost Clock | 1035 MHz |
| 1500 MHz 12 Gbps effective | Memory Clock | 770 MHz 1540 Mbps effective |
Render Config
| 2304 | Shading Units | 2560 |
| 144 | TMUs | 160 |
| 64 | ROPs | 64 |
| 4 MB | L2 Cache | 4 MB |
Board Design
| MXM Module | Slot Width | IGP |
| 90 W | Thermal design power (TDP) | 50 W |
| No outputs | Display Connectors | No outputs |
| None | Power Connectors | None |
API support
| 12 Ultimate (12_2) | DirectX | 12 (12_1) |
| 4.6 | OpenGL | 4.6 |
| 3.0 | OpenCL | 2.2 |
| 1.2 | Vulkan | 1.2 |
| 6.6 | Shader Model | 6.5 |
